Transaction efb760bd6c370d0f09c518fa695305384e1874190a0696b0b1175599d76cabd8
1 Input
1 Output
-
efb760bd6c370d0f09c518fa695305384e1874190a0696b0b1175599d76cabd8:0
- value
- 20822624
- script pubkey
- OP_0 OP_PUSHBYTES_20 db9c8f357a2a377f94bb2b94dc2854d3dae63caf
- address
- bc1qmwwg7dt69gmhl99m9w2dc2z560dwv090etk3xt